### 2024-Q3 Key Rotation — Dispatch Heuristic

Heads up, on-call folks: we rotated the signing key for the Wrenroute driver-assignment heuristic bundle. The old key stops working at the next deploy window, so don't reuse cached configs. If you need to push a hotfix to the heuristic weights, sign it with the new key below.

deploy key for yajeg-hahog: bky3_BZq

Quick summary for the driver's coordinator: the new uniforms from Tressgard Workwear are boxed and ready — 42 sets, sized per the sheet Marta circulated. We agreed drivers at Kestrel Point switch over from Monday, old kit returned by end of month. Hi-vis layers are in a separate carton, don't let them get split from the main shipment. Delivery goes out Thursday with Bramblefield Couriers. On arrival, the driver should carry out the confidential hand-over step noted immediately below.

dispatch memo: the eliath belael courier leaves the praox ledger at gate 8841 under passcode 017589

## Dark Mode — Admin Dashboard

Ownership: Parchment team owns theming tokens for the Quillboard admin dashboard. Component-level dark-mode bugs go to the Surfaces squad. Do not file against platform. Known gaps: charts, date picker. Rollout target is next quarter; no firm date. For anything theming-related, including token change requests, contact the team directly.

escalation mailbox, yajeg-bageg: quenax.olidor@lumiccorp.internal